DROP FUNCTION IF EXISTS format_statement;
|
|
|
|
DELIMITER $$
|
|
|
|
CREATE DEFINER='mariadb.sys'@'localhost' FUNCTION format_statement (
|
|
statement LONGTEXT
|
|
)
|
|
RETURNS LONGTEXT
|
|
COMMENT '
|
|
Description
|
|
-----------
|
|
|
|
Formats a normalized statement, truncating it if it is > 64 characters long by default.
|
|
|
|
To configure the length to truncate the statement to by default, update the `statement_truncate_len`
|
|
variable with `sys_config` table to a different value. Alternatively, to change it just for just
|
|
your particular session, use `SET @sys.statement_truncate_len := <some new value>`.
|
|
|
|
Useful for printing statement related data from Performance Schema from
|
|
the command line.
|
|
|
|
Parameters
|
|
-----------
|
|
|
|
statement (LONGTEXT):
|
|
The statement to format.
|
|
|
|
Returns
|
|
-----------
|
|
|
|
LONGTEXT
|
|
|
|
Example
|
|
-----------
|
|
|
|
mysql> SELECT sys.format_statement(digest_text)
|
|
-> FROM performance_schema.events_statements_summary_by_digest
|
|
-> ORDER by sum_timer_wait DESC limit 5;
|
|
+-------------------------------------------------------------------+
|
|
| sys.format_statement(digest_text) |
|
|
+-------------------------------------------------------------------+
|
|
| CREATE SQL SECURITY INVOKER VI ... KE ? AND `variable_value` > ? |
|
|
| CREATE SQL SECURITY INVOKER VI ... ait` IS NOT NULL , `esc` . ... |
|
|
| CREATE SQL SECURITY INVOKER VI ... ait` IS NOT NULL , `sys` . ... |
|
|
| CREATE SQL SECURITY INVOKER VI ... , `compressed_size` ) ) DESC |
|
|
| CREATE SQL SECURITY INVOKER VI ... LIKE ? ORDER BY `timer_start` |
|
|
+-------------------------------------------------------------------+
|
|
5 rows in set (0.00 sec)
|
|
'
|
|
SQL SECURITY INVOKER
|
|
DETERMINISTIC
|
|
NO SQL
|
|
BEGIN
|
|
-- Check if we have the configured length, if not, init it
|
|
IF @sys.statement_truncate_len IS NULL THEN
|
|
SET @sys.statement_truncate_len = sys_get_config('statement_truncate_len', 64);
|
|
END IF;
|
|
|
|
IF CHAR_LENGTH(statement) > @sys.statement_truncate_len THEN
|
|
RETURN REPLACE(CONCAT(LEFT(statement, (@sys.statement_truncate_len/2)-2), ' ... ', RIGHT(statement, (@sys.statement_truncate_len/2)-2)), '\n', ' ');
|
|
ELSE
|
|
RETURN REPLACE(statement, '\n', ' ');
|
|
END IF;
|
|
END$$
|
|
|
|
DELIMITER ;
